6 vehicles seized, 71 challans issued in Sopore

Sopore, Apr 03 (KNO): Police here in north Kashmir's Sopore on Thursday seized over six vehicles, even as 71 challans were issued against traffic violators. An official told the news agency—Kashmir News Observer (KNO) that the special drive was aimed to enforce traffic regulations and ensure road safety. It led to seizure of six vehicles and the issuance of 71 challans, he said. Spearheading the drive, DySP Traffic North Kashmir, Mujahid Nazir, along with SHO Amargrah, Sajad Ahmed emphasized the importance of such initiatives in curbing reckless driving, overloading, and other traffic violations that endanger lives. “This drive is part of our continuous efforts to instill traffic discipline among motorists. The increasing number of violations necessitates strict enforcement to ensure the safety of all road users. Our message is clear—traffic rules must be followed, and violators will face strict action,” said DySP Nazir. It is noteworthy that the special drive focused on checking documents, overloading, helmet compliance for two-wheeler riders, and adherence to road safety measures. Meanwhile, officials stressed that such drives would continue in the coming days to discourage irresponsible driving practices and create a safer commuting environment. They, however, urged the public to cooperate with law enforcement agencies and adhere to traffic rules to prevent accidents and ensure smooth vehicular movement in the town—(KNO)
